Skip to content

Instantly share code, notes, and snippets.

@raphaelLacerda
Created June 17, 2016 01:00
Show Gist options
  • Save raphaelLacerda/fb2eaa668e4b46c6242368769865ff12 to your computer and use it in GitHub Desktop.
Save raphaelLacerda/fb2eaa668e4b46c6242368769865ff12 to your computer and use it in GitHub Desktop.

http://blog.caelum.com.br/como-posso-aprender-java-e-iniciar-na-carreira/

http://blog.caelum.com.br/java-menos-verboso-com-lombok/

http://blog.caelum.com.br/integracao-continua-de-projeto-java-com-jenkins/

http://blog.caelum.com.br/classes-aninhadas-o-que-sao-e-quando-usar/

http://blog.caelum.com.br/comecando-com-parametros-e-configuracoes-da-jvm/

http://blog.caelum.com.br/agendamento-de-tarefas-em-aplicacoes-web-um-truque-com-quartz/

http://blog.caelum.com.br/nao-posso-descobrir-nem-instanciar-tipos-genericos-porque/

http://blog.caelum.com.br/performance-hashset-em-vez-de-arraylist/

http://blog.caelum.com.br/ensinando-que-e-o-hashcode/

-------------hibernate------------------------------ http://blog.caelum.com.br/adequar-o-banco-as-entidades-ou-o-contrario/

http://blog.caelum.com.br/enfrentando-a-lazyinitializationexception-no-hibernate/

http://blog.caelum.com.br/divisions-com-hibernate-uso-avancado-da-criteria-api/

http://blog.caelum.com.br/jpa-anotacoes-nos-getters-ou-atributos/

http://blog.caelum.com.br/hibernate-search-com-lucene/

http://blog.caelum.com.br/jpa-com-hibernate-heranca-e-mapeamentos/

http://blog.caelum.com.br/entidades-managed-transient-e-detached-no-hibernate-e-jpa/

http://blog.caelum.com.br/transientobjectexception-lazyinitializationexception-e-outras-famosas-do-hibernate/ ---------------------------OO

http://blog.caelum.com.br/codigo-conciso-claro-e-breve/

http://blog.caelum.com.br/como-medir-a-coesao-lcom/

http://blog.caelum.com.br/medindo-a-complexidade-do-seu-codigo/

http://blog.caelum.com.br/orientacao-a-objetos-uma-outra-perspectiva-sobre-o-acoplamento/

http://blog.caelum.com.br/revisitando-a-orientacao-a-objetos-encapsulamento-no-java/

http://blog.caelum.com.br/principios-do-codigo-solido-na-orientacao-a-objetos/

http://blog.caelum.com.br/como-nao-aprender-orientacao-a-objetos-o-excesso-de-ifs/

http://blog.caelum.com.br/como-nao-aprender-orientacao-a-objetos-heranca/

http://blog.caelum.com.br/o-que-e-modelo-anemico-e-por-que-fugir-dele/

http://blog.caelum.com.br/pequenos-objetos-imutaveis-e-tiny-types/

http://blog.caelum.com.br/dsls-nao-sao-para-gerentes/

http://blog.caelum.com.br/domain-specific-languages-em-acao/

------------------------------_CSS/JS

http://blog.caelum.com.br/boas-praticas-com-javascript-e-jquery-codigo-nao-obstrusivo/ http://blog.caelum.com.br/seu-codigo-css-pode-ser-mais-limpo-flexivel-e-reaproveitavel/ http://blog.caelum.com.br/css-facil-flexivel-e-dinamico-com-less/ http://blog.caelum.com.br/boas-praticas-com-javascript-e-jquery-codigo-nao-obstrusivo/ http://blog.caelum.com.br/otimizacoes-na-web-e-o-carregamento-assincrono/

####TESTES

http://blog.caelum.com.br/o-que-a-quantidade-de-asserts-em-um-teste-nos-diz-sobre-o-codigo/

http://blog.caelum.com.br/melhorando-a-legibilidade-dos-seus-testes-com-o-hamcrest/

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ment